NBI flags 47 flood control projects in Davao City

National Bureau of Investigation (NBI) Director Melvin Matibag on Thursday said they received documents regarding nearly 50 alleged ghost and substandard flood control projects in Davao City.

He said 47 out of 100 flood control projects in one district were “somewhat” flagged but later added that only six of the 47 were “clearly” problematic.

“We received documents from the Department of Public Works that there are projects na medyo naka red-flag,” Matibag said in an ambush interview.

(We received documents from the Department of Public Works showing that there are projects that are somewhat red-flagged.)

“Merong ghost, merong substandard, merong isang coordinates lang with five budgets na iba-iba lang ‘yung title,” he added.

(There are ghost projects, there are substandard projects, and there is one set of coordinates with five different budgets, with only the titles being different.)

Matibag said that P1.9 billion in the district of Davao Representative Paolo "Pulong" Duterte were awarded to a contractor owned by an individual that is close to them.

The director said the bureau will issue subpoenas to three contractors as well as the Department of Public Works and Highways.

When asked if the the NBI will issue a subpoena to Duterte, Matibag said no.

“Hindi naman siya, ‘yung DPWH naman. HIndi ko nga alam kung bakit siya nagagalit. Ang papatawag naman natin ‘yung contractor at ‘yung DPWH,” he said.

(It’s not him, it’s the DPWH. I don’t even know why he is getting angry. The ones we will summon are the contractor and the DPWH.) — BM, GMA News
